Dear CFD Online Members,

I am a PhD student studying the porosity found in animal bones.

As a part of my research I wanted to color code the vascular canals segmented from the bone scans based on their diameter variations using a color map.

I had scanned a bone at a very high resolution of around 1 µm in a Micro CT machine and segmented the vascular canals from the bone scans as shown in the attached image.

I was working with AMIRA/AVIZO software from FEI and CTAN software from Bruker but I could not generate color coding using this softwares

I am curious to know if any CFD Online members can suggest any software tools that allow me to color code the vascular canals based on their diameter and display the results in a color map

Looking forward to any comments
